Greetings,

Since everyone dislikes this mechanic, I figure we could throw out some ideas to make it, and by extension the LA, not as much of a problem. This is mostly for general ideas, less numbers specific, so here goes.

1) Reverse the flesh hook mechanic to more of a targeted damaging warlock leap. Still does full damage and allows the LA to quickly close with its target, but with a higher risk to itself.

2) Make the pull half the distance, and launch the LA towards it for the same amount. Exposes both the LA and the target, but less so than before

Thoughts?
